The Steam Machine Returns: Beyond the Initial Stumbles

The original Steam Machines, launched in 2015, were met with lukewarm reception. High prices, inconsistent hardware, and a lack of clear differentiation hampered their success. This time, Valve appears to be learning from those mistakes. The focus isn’t on creating a single, standardized machine, but rather on establishing a “Verified” ecosystem. This means third-party manufacturers can build Steam Machines, but they must meet specific criteria to earn the Valve stamp of approval. This verification process, detailed at GDC 2026, covers hardware compatibility, software integration, and performance benchmarks.

Crucially, the new Steam Machines will support standalone operation – meaning they aren’t tethered to a Steam Deck-like reliance on a single storefront. This opens the door for broader compatibility and potentially attracts a wider audience. The success of this venture hinges on pricing, a point gamers are already keenly focused on, as evidenced by the unified reaction to potential price points reported by Screen Rant.

Steam Frame: The Modular PC Revolution?

Perhaps the most intriguing announcement is Steam Frame. This isn’t a complete PC, but a modular system designed to be the core of a custom-built gaming rig. Valve will verify compatible components – CPUs, GPUs, motherboards, and more – ensuring seamless integration with SteamOS and the Steam ecosystem. This addresses a major pain point for PC gamers: compatibility issues and the often-daunting task of building a PC from scratch.

The implications are significant. Steam Frame could lower the barrier to entry for PC gaming, making it more accessible to console players. It also offers a level of customization that pre-built PCs often lack. Imagine a future where you can upgrade individual components with confidence, knowing they’ve been vetted by Valve. This could foster a thriving market for verified components and potentially disrupt the traditional PC hardware supply chain.

The Rise of Verified Hardware and the Ecosystem Lock-In

Valve’s verification strategy is a double-edged sword. While it promises a smoother user experience, it also creates a walled garden. Gamers will likely be incentivized to choose verified components, potentially limiting their options and driving up costs. However, the convenience and peace of mind offered by a guaranteed-compatible system may outweigh these concerns for many.

This move also positions Valve as a central authority in the PC hardware space, a role it has largely avoided in the past. It’s a strategic play to strengthen its ecosystem and increase its control over the gaming experience. The question is whether gamers will embrace this level of control or resist it in favor of greater freedom and flexibility.
